WebAccording to the American Kennel Club (AKC) Official Breed Standards 1, the size of a male Great Pyrenees weighs over 100 pounds and stands 27 to 32 inches in height from the ground to the top of the shoulders. Comparatively, the female Great Pyrenees is smaller in size, weighing over 85 pounds and standing between 25 and 29 inches tall. WebNov 13, 2024 · The Great Pyrenees head shape is a slight wedge with a muzzle and skull of equal lengths and a slightly rounded crown. With the correct proportions, the Great Pyrenees should have a gradually sloping stop. The eyes are almond-shaped and dark, and the ears should be small or medium in size. WebThe Great Pyrenees has a broad and blocky head, while the Kuvasz’s head is not as wide. Besides, the Kuvasz’s head comes to a slight stop while the Great Pyrenees’ head comes to a more pronounced stop. 3. Lifespan.
